rapid doors, also known as high-speed doors, are designed to open and close quickly, allowing for seamless and efficient traffic flow. These doors are typically made of durable materials such as PVC, aluminum, or steel, making them perfect for high-traffic areas like warehouses, manufacturing plants, and distribution centers. Unlike traditional doors that can be slow and cumbersome to operate, rapid doors can open and close in a matter of seconds, minimizing downtime and increasing productivity.
One of the key benefits of rapid doors is their speed. In a fast-paced environment where every second counts, having a door that can open and close quickly is essential. rapid doors can help streamline operations by reducing wait times for vehicles and personnel. Whether it’s a forklift moving goods in a warehouse or a truck entering a loading bay, rapid doors ensure that traffic flows smoothly and efficiently.
Another advantage of rapid doors is their energy efficiency. Traditional doors can be a major source of heat loss in a facility, especially if they are left open for extended periods of time. rapid doors are designed to open and close quickly, helping to maintain the desired temperature inside the building and reduce energy costs. By minimizing heat loss and air infiltration, rapid doors can help businesses save money on heating and cooling expenses.
In addition to speed and energy efficiency, rapid doors also offer enhanced safety features. These doors are equipped with sensors that detect obstacles in their path, preventing accidents and injuries. Rapid doors can also be reinforced to withstand high winds and extreme weather conditions, making them ideal for outdoor applications. By prioritizing safety, rapid doors help create a secure working environment for employees and protect valuable assets from potential damage.
Rapid doors have a wide range of applications across various industries. In warehouses, rapid doors can help facilitate the smooth flow of goods in and out of the facility. They are ideal for loading docks, where speed and efficiency are crucial for meeting shipping deadlines. In manufacturing plants, rapid doors can separate different areas of production while allowing for quick and easy access for equipment and personnel. In cold storage facilities, rapid doors can help maintain the desired temperature and prevent frost buildup.
